I fast twenty-four hours fairly regularly.<br />
I do seventy-two-hour fasts approximately every three<br />
months.<br />
And you know what, they aren’t that big of a deal.<br />
When I am fasting, I still do everything I would<br />
normally do if I were eating. I work. Work out. Train<br />
jiu-jitsu.<br />
I drink water, some tea, maybe eat some sunflower<br />
seeds in the shell just to have something to chew on.<br />
But fasting isn’t that hard and you will feel better<br />
at the end of it. Fasting will recalibrate what<br />
hunger is to you. You will realize that you aren’t<br />
actually hungry most of the time. You are just bored.<br />
And, at the end of a fast, your food will taste<br />
better, too.
